8.6 Environmental Considerations
Environments outside the specification reduce the lifetime and may irreparably damage the
X-ray Detector.
Table 7 Environmental Conditions
Category Limits
Storage & Transport Temperature (ambient) -20º C to +55º C
Operating Temperature (ambient) 10º C to 40º C
T1 Temperature Sensor Minimum >
16º C
T2 Temperature Sensor Minimum >
16º C
T1 Temperature Sensor Maximum <
46º C
T2 Temperature Sensor Maximum <
46º C
Storage and Operating Humidity Range (non-condensing) 10% to 90%
Atmospheric Pressure Range 70kPa to 106kPa
Shock (any direction no power applied) 20G
Vibration Tolerance (25Hz, 30 min each Axis, without power) 2.5G
Ingress Protection IP68
Detector Altitude Operates at ≤ 3000m
Note
The T1 and T2 temperature sensors are used to monitor the internal
temperature of the glass. These are the only temperature sensors that need to
be monitored by the OEM, see Table 7.
